So far, I’ve not been too impressed by the design of the reissued Polaroid cameras. Perhaps they can work alongside designer Evan Jardee, who cooked up this glossy flip concept which looks more like a phone than an instant camera?

I’ve got a couple of issues with it though. Firstly—it’s unable to print photos without docking in a printer (albeit an equally-stylish printer), and secondly it contains a flexible OLED screen for displaying photos on. Part of the charm of Polaroids is not really knowing what you’re going to get when it prints out seconds after shooting, but with 10GB of imaginary memory, it becomes more of a concept camera than a concept Polaroid.

Nonetheless, it’s a beautiful concept—I’ll give the designer that. [Yanko Design]
